Durham, before Milton Road

On Duddingston Park, near at 34

Buses point south ↓

To Scheduled
21 Edinburgh Royal Infirmary 05:28
21 Edinburgh Royal Infirmary 06:29
49 Newcraighall 06:47
21 Edinburgh Royal Infirmary 06:59
49 Newcraighall 07:28
21 Edinburgh Royal Infirmary 07:31
49 Newcraighall 07:59
21 Edinburgh Royal Infirmary 08:02
21 Edinburgh Royal Infirmary 08:32
49 Newcraighall 08:33
21 Edinburgh Royal Infirmary 08:57
49 Newcraighall 09:05

Later ↓

Bus services

Nearby stops

Map